Abstract
We report some photorefractive higher-order diffraction phenomena of two kinds of photorefractive nematic liquid crystal materials. In the experiment, we observed the superposition of higher-order diffraction images, the coupling of higher-order diffraction lights, and the coupling between higher-order diffraction lights and incident beams. The observed behavior suggests the complexity of the coupling process. The properties of higher-order diffraction images are discussed theoretically, which are in good agreement with experimental results.
